Support Engineer Jobs in Washington: Frequently Asked Questions

Which companies sponsor visas for support engineers in Washington?

Microsoft, Amazon, and Salesforce are among the most active sponsors of support engineers in Washington, particularly in the Seattle and Redmond areas. Companies like Tableau (now part of Salesforce), F5 Networks, and Smartsheet have also filed Labor Condition Applications for support engineering roles. Sponsorship activity is concentrated in enterprise software, cloud infrastructure, and SaaS companies headquartered or with major operations in the state.

Which visa types are most common for support engineer roles in Washington?

The H-1B visa is the most common visa for support engineers in Washington, provided the role requires a bachelor's degree in a specific technical field such as computer science or information systems. Canadians and Mexicans may qualify for TN visa status under the "computer systems analyst" or "engineer" categories, depending on job duties. Australian nationals may be eligible for the E-3 visa, which has no lottery and is available year-round.

Which cities in Washington have the most support engineer sponsorship jobs?

Seattle accounts for the largest share of support engineer sponsorship jobs in Washington, followed closely by Redmond and Bellevue, which host major campuses for Microsoft and other enterprise tech companies. Kirkland and Bothell also have a meaningful presence of mid-size software firms that hire support engineers. Outside the Puget Sound region, Spokane has a smaller but growing tech hiring base.

Are there any state-specific considerations for support engineers seeking sponsorship in Washington?

Washington has no state income tax, which affects prevailing wage comparisons since take-home pay differs from states like California or New York. For H-1B purposes, the Department of Labor's prevailing wage for support engineer roles in the Seattle metropolitan area tends to be higher than the national average, reflecting the region's elevated cost of living. Employers must meet or exceed that wage level when filing a Labor Condition Application.

What is the prevailing wage for sponsored support engineer jobs in Washington?

U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
